Elements Influencing the Price of a Fridge
The price of a refrigerator can vary considerably based upon several essential elements:
Type of Fridge
Various types of refrigerators serve various purposes and have varying price points. Common types consist of:
Top-freezer refrigeratorsBottom-freezer refrigeratorsSide-by-side refrigeratorsFrench door refrigeratorsMini fridgesSmart fridges
Size and Capacity
Refrigerators come in various sizes, usually determined in cubic feet. Larger designs with greater capability tend to be more expensive compared to smaller sized ones. Purchasers need to consider their space and storage needs.
Features and Technology
The addition of sophisticated features can likewise impact the price.
Energy effectiveness (Energy Star certification)Temperature control settingsWater and ice dispensersSmart innovation (Wi-Fi connectivity, app controls)Adjustable shelving and storage choices
Brand Reputation
Reputable brands typically come at a premium due to their reputation for quality and service. Customers might pay more for brand names that provide dependability and customer assistance.
Energy Efficiency
Energy-efficient models can save money on long-term utility expenses, but usually have greater upfront prices.
Product and Design
High-end materials, such as stainless-steel, and modern styles can increase the price of a fridge.
Table: Refrigerator Price Ranges by TypeRefrigerator TypePrice Range (GBP)Top-Freezer₤ 400 - ₤ 1,200Bottom-Freezer₤ 700 - ₤ 2,500Side-by-Side₤ 800 - ₤ 3,000French Door₤ 1,200 - ₤ 4,500Mini Fridges₤ 100 - ₤ 600Smart Fridges₤ 1,500 - ₤ 5,000Estimated Annual Operating Cost
When identifying the expense of a refrigerator, it's also essential to think about the projected yearly operating expense. Energy-efficient designs may have higher initial expenses however lower operational expenses over time.
Device ModelEstimated Yearly Energy Cost (GBP)Standard Model₤ 150Energy-Efficient Model₤ 75Smart Model₤ 100Secret Considerations When Buying a Fridge
When thinking about the purchase of a refrigerator, consumers ought to keep the list below consider mind:
Space Availability: Measure the area in the kitchen area to guarantee that the brand-new fridge price will fit conveniently, remembering door swing and ventilation requirements.
Capability Needs: Evaluate home requirements for food storage. Households may require bigger fridges, while songs or couples may choose for compact designs.
Budget: Set a budget that thinks about not simply the purchase price, however likewise approximated operational costs.
Select Features Wisely: Not all functions may be required. Prioritize the most essential functions such as energy efficiency and personalized storage options based upon personal requirements.
Brand name and Warranty: Research various brands and examine warranty options. A longer guarantee might show much better quality and supply peace of mind.
FAQs1. What is the typical life expectancy of a refrigerator?
The average life-span of a refrigerator has to do with 13 years. Regular maintenance can extend this duration.
2. Are wise refrigerators worth the investment?
Smart refrigerators use convenience and advanced features however normally included a greater price tag. Assess if these features line up with your lifestyle.
3. What are Energy Star home appliances?
Energy Star appliances are licensed to be more energy-efficient than standard designs, causing lower energy expenses and environmental effect.
4. How frequently should a refrigerator be changed?
Changing a refrigerator must be considered when it begins to reveal signs of failure, such as extreme frost, poor performance, or frequent repair work.
5. Is it much better to buy a fridge during sales?
Yes, acquiring a refrigerator during major sales occasions like Black Friday, Memorial Day, or end-of-season clearance can lead to substantial cost savings.
